Performance Portability in the Physical Parameterizations of the Community Atmospheric Model
- 1 August 2005
- journal article
- research article
- Published by SAGE Publications in The International Journal of High Performance Computing Applications
- Vol. 19 (3) , 187-201
- https://doi.org/10.1177/1094342005056095
Abstract
Community models for global climate research, such as the Community Atmospheric Model, must perform well on a variety of computing systems. Supporting diverse research interests, these computationally demanding models must be efficient for a range of problem sizes and processor counts. In this paper we describe the data structures and associated infrastructure developed for the physical parameterizations that allow the Community Atmospheric Model to be tuned for vector or non-vector systems, to provide load balancing while minimizing communication overhead, and to exploit the optimal mix of distributed Message Passing Interface (MPI) processes and shared OpenMP threads.Keywords
This publication has 16 references indexed in Scilit:
- A Scalable Implementation of a Finite-Volume Dynamical Core in the Community Atmosphere ModelThe International Journal of High Performance Computing Applications, 2005
- Cross-Platform Performance of a Portable Communication Module and the Nasa Finite Volume General Circulation ModelThe International Journal of High Performance Computing Applications, 2005
- The Community Climate System ModelBulletin of the American Meteorological Society, 2001
- Automated empirical optimizations of software and the ATLAS projectParallel Computing, 2001
- Co-array Fortran for parallel programmingACM SIGPLAN Fortran Forum, 1998
- OpenMP: an industry standard API for shared-memory programmingIEEE Computational Science and Engineering, 1998
- The IFS model: A parallel production weather codeParallel Computing, 1995
- Design and performance of a scalable parallel community climate modelParallel Computing, 1995
- Climate Simulations with a Semi-Lagrangian Version of the NCAR Community Climate ModelMonthly Weather Review, 1994
- Two-Dimensional Semi-Lagrangian Transport with Shape-Preserving InterpolationMonthly Weather Review, 1989